Requiring the commissioner of health and mental hygiene to establish a green Monday program for the provision of plant-based food by certain city agencies and in food service establishments.
A Local Law to amend the administrative code of the city of New York, in relation to requiring the commissioner of health and mental hygiene to establish a green Monday program for the provision of plant-based food by certain city agencies and in food service establishments, and to educate the public about the benefits of eating plant-based food
This bill would require the Commissioner of Health and Mental Hygiene to coordinate a Green Monday Program through which certain city agencies would serve only plant-based food on Mondays and any city food service establishment may obtain a Green Monday display certificate by certifying to the Commissioner that the establishment only serves plant-based food on Mondays. The Commissioner of Health and Mental Hygiene would also be required to work with the Commissioner of Environmental Protection to create educational materials for the general public on the benefits of eating plant-based food.
